Few useful tips how to increase the lifespan of an SSD
Few useful
tips how to increase the lifespan of an SSD
1. Do not
defragment your SSD. SSD does not suffer performance loss caused by
fragmentation. Defragmenting it, will
only fatigue it, but it will not increase it’s performance. You sacrifice it’s life
for nothing in return. Slowing down on an SSD, means the SSD is wearing out,
and it needs wear leveling. Slowing down of an SSD is caused down, because of
Error correction code being used, to try to correct not fully or not properly
read data, after multiple retries to make a good read. Self Healing and wear
leveling will fix this for some number of times, but ultimately, the SSD will
die.
Bicycle brakes - brake pads alignment
Bicycle
brakes - brake pads alignment
Bicycle
brakes evolved over time, increasing stopping power, from inadequate low – so
low, it is beyond useless, to insanely high – modern hydraulic disc brakes,
offer incredible amount of braking power, by gently squeezing them with one
finger. The biggest breakthrough came when engineers, realized 2 things:
1 That you
can create insanely strong brakes, but if braking pads are NOT properly aligned,
this braking power is lost. This is why adjustable brake pads were created,
with some free play designed into them in order to allow them to align
properly.
2. The brake
must have proper balance left-to-right, in order to distribute brakeforce
evenly.
Disc brake dynamics - The actual difference between mechanical disc brake and hydraulic disc brake
Disc brake dynamics - The actual difference
between mechanical disc brake and hydraulic disc brake
Regardless
how much engineers try to convince us, that modern high end mechanical disc
brakes, controlled by high-end braking cables and high-end cable housings, can
be real match to a hydraulic disc brake, the actual picture is quite different.
Mechanical brakes suffer from cable stretching, regardless of everything. Yes,
yes, I know the blah-blah-blah-blah that high-end cable in high-end cable
housing do not suffer that much as low-end cables in low-end housings… but at
the end of the day, the high-end cable also stretches. Even this combo has so
called slack, which appears and accumulates during long term use. This is the
reason for the brake to be inefficient, in most cases. Another issue is that
almost all mechanical disk brakes have only one moving piston, which moves only
one brake pad. In this case the static one must be set up properly a tiny hair
away from braking disk, in order to make it work at all. This is the reason for
50% of inefficiency, and the braking cable stretching is the other reason that
causes inefficiency.

The nonsense of: “Nothing to hide, nothing to fear”
You may have read or heard the statement, “nothing to hide, nothing to fear” from some people, especially from people in authority. The problem is that it’s not true.
The statement is made with the implicit claim that the people who are watching you only have your best interests at heart; that they are fair, honest, and will never abuse their power. How can we know this? Even if it is true now, how can we be sure that the situation won’t change in the future? The answer is obvious: we can’t be sure of these things. The more secret they are, the less sure we can be. And the less we should trust them.
Governments change and so do their attitudes to freedom. The laws we allow now will last for a very long time – it is very difficult to undo a law, no matter how unfair. That is why we should make sure we limit the power governments, police, and security services have over our digital freedom. And we should do it now. What we lose today we may lose forever.
Why does this matter? The power to invade our digital freedom gives people the ability to discriminate against us without us ever knowing. They’ll never have to ask inappropriate, unfair, or illegal questions because they'll know the answers already.
In the supposedly free world we have our own fears. For example, imagine if you could never look for new jobs without your employer knowing. Imagine if you could never go to the doctor without an insurance company checking your results. Imagine if you could never have something that was yours alone.
What if you couldn't do a single thing without always worrying whether it would or could jeopardise your future in some unknown, unforeseeable way?
A world in which we are afraid of the people in power is a world we hoped we had left behind. In other countries people don’t have to imagine what they might have to fear. Their reality is that they can never vote against the government for fear of punishment and that they can never complain about the police for fear of a beating.
This is what supporters of “nothing to hide, nothing to fear” forget. It’s not about whether they can trust us, it’s about whether we can trust them.

Rules of Malware fight
Rules of Malware fight
1. Do not get cocky
Underestimating the level of threat, that malware poses, actually means you have no idea who your enemy is, what it is capable of.
2. Never say never
Never say, malware cannot infect you. There is no invulnerable OS, there is no impenetrable defense.
3. Never trust compromised OS
You can never trust malware to be honest. Once the system is broken It is no longer trustworthy.
4. Do not leave things halfway done
Malware always finds way to revive itself. Either finish it, do all the work fully and completely, or do not bother starting. Never leave malware executables left on the system, even if their autoruns are removed.
5. If it can be done, it is already done
Do not take Security as granted. Do you really know, which exploits your computer is vulnerable of? There are only two types of computers - These which are infected and these which will be infected.
6. Be prepared
Make sure you are familiar with the enemy, and you have the proper tools for the job, and the proper knowledge to use the tools properly. Each malware is it's own case, it requires it's own attention and knowledge and tools...
7. It has fangs and claws and it knows how to use them
Be very careful, be extremely careful. Treat malware with utmost care and respect. It is so easy to make a mistake and make the malware to backfire on you.
8. Copy me, I love to travel
When taking on malware, ALWAYS use read-only media with your tools, or bootable read-only media, created with updated tools. When cleaning thumb drives, do it from bootable read-only media, created with updated tools, while your main Hard Drive is PHYSICALLY DISCONNECTED!

Зевс, новият банков троянски кон
Говорейки за вируси, червеи, троянски коне, рууткити, определено бих се притеснил, ако създателите на тези изроди ми кажат:
Works as advertised, and delivers as promised.
Бих се притеснил двойно, ако това изречение ми го каже някой голям и сериозен секюрити рисърчър, например като Брус Шнайер, Стив Гибсън, Марк Русинович, Райндол Шварц, Брайън Кребс, или ако анализирам гадината и сам видя че наистина Works as advertised, and delivers as promised.
Така днес си грах с един троянски кон, исках да го анализирам, да го видя какво прави, как го прави и къде. Ето и резултатите от анализа ми. Това е гадина която ОПРЕДЕЛЕНО НЕ ЖЕЛАЕТЕ да ви се лепне на компютъра.
Когато получих мострата от Стив Гибсън от GRC.COM, Microsoft Secrity Essentials не го познаваше, докладваше го за чист. Пратих им копие на мострата, заедно с кратичко описанииче що е то в зип архива, признаха го, потвърдиха че е най-новия зевс, и ми отдадоха заслугата. 24 часа след като го пратих, ми казаха че са признали мострата и са направили дефиниция да го познава по мойта мостра.
поиграх си малко с него, и с инструментите на Марк Русинович Sysinternals tools и направих този кратък анализ.
Зевс е троянски кон, който се разпространява, с фишинг емайл, и поради тази причина създава и използва ботмрежа с името Zbot.
Троянският кон, използва рууткит, за да прикрие присъствието си – файлове, процеси, тредове, записи в регистри.
Рууткита, реагира късно да пази троянския кон, чак когато сте притеснително бизо до троянския кон – тоест ако не търсите троянския кон, рууткита няма да реагира за да не се издаде. Чак когато степритеснително близо до него, рууткита режава че не сте там случайно а с цел и реагира на ставащото.
Рууткита се прикрива като гугълска услуга, за да може, дори при неговото разкриване, да се опита да изглежда като нещо невинно. Камуфлаж.
Рууткита и троянският кон, са създадени, да работят на неадминистраторски акаунт, без права и привилегии, и притеснителното е че го правят, безупречно.
Троянският кон, се опитва да се отпише от системните защити на паметта – DEP – Data Execution Prevention, ASLR – Address Space Layout Randomization и SEHOP – Structured Exception Handler Overwrite Protection. Ако не успее, става още по-притеснително, използва нов пробив в системата за шрифтове, за да получи права на администратор и на системен процес на ядрото – kernel ring 0 с които тотално изключва споменатите защити.
Троянският кон, работи с папките на потребителя в потребителския профил, и в частите на регистри отнасящи се до текущият потребител. Тъй като се правят промени за текущият потребител, троянският кон няма нужда от администраторски права, за да зарази системата и да се запише за автоматично стартиране.
Троянският кон записва 2 файлана хард диска, единият от които е рууткита, който крие всичко, а другият е троянският кон, който бива скрит от рууткита.
Папката в която се записва рууткита е:
При 64 битова версия на уиндоус:
C:\program files x86\google\desktop\install\random named folder 1\random named folder 2\random named folder 3\googleupdate.exe
При 32 битова версия на уиндоус:
C:\program files\google\desktop\install\random named folder 1\random named folder 2\random named folder 3\googleupdate.exe
Където папките с имена random named folder всъщност са папки с произволни имена.
Папката в която се записва самият троянски кон е:
C:\users\current user folder\appdata\local\google\desktop\install\random named folder 1\random named folder 2\random named folder 3\randomfilename.exe
Където randomfilename значи произволно име на файла, и Където папките с имена random named folder всъщност са папки с произволни имена.
Имената на файла и на папките нарочно са произволни, и се създават за всеки заразен компютър произволни, за да може, да няма видими общи белези, между заразените компютри. Още една техника за прикриване на присъствието си.
При стартиране на заразеният компютър, операционната система зарежда рууткита, след като рууткита се стартира, заработи и се скрие, рууткита стартира троянския кон и го прикрива.
Рууткита се записва в регистри за автоматично стартиране в частта на регистри за текущият потребител:
HKEY_Current_User\Microsoft\Windows\Current_Version\Run
Интересното е че като система за пририване, това не успява да го направи. Опита му ма прикриване е белега който го издава. Записа на файла за автоматично стартиране бива прикрит с разместване на буквите в името на файла, и файла се вижда като:
exe.etadpuelgoog
но като наместите буквите правилно, се появява истинското име на файла:
googleupdate.exe
Това че всичко е разместено, привлича погледа. Обикновенов регистри всички имена са коректно споменати и няма опити за прикриван и завоалиране на имена, и за това така завоалирано името привлича внимание. единственото завоалирано има на фона на всички останали незавоалирани, за това по-горе казах че не успява и че опита за прикриване е това окето го издава.
Рууткита и троянският кон са маркирани като Safe Boot което означава, че уиндоус ги стартира при зареждане на компютъра в обичайния safe mode. Проблемът се утежнява, защото също бива зареден и в Safe mode with VGA и Safe Mode with Networking, защото в последният режим, троянският кон директно си се връзва в неговата бот мрежа и всичко работи на 100%
Хубавото, е че не се зарежда в най-минималистичния и най-орязаният режим – Safe mode with command prompt. Ех добрият стар дос, хората от старата школа, знаят за какво говоря. В този режим, не е проблем да навигирате с командите на дос, и да изтриете файловете на зевс и рууткита, и да използвате Autoruns sysinternals инструмента, за да премахнете записа за автоматично стартиране от регистри.
Веднъж троянският кон, стартиран от рууткита, и скрит от рууткита, веднага се закача за клавиатурата, и търпеливо анализира всичко което набирате от клавиатурата, за да види може ли да извади акаунти за електронно банкиране, данни за кредитни или дебитни карти, данни за банкови сметки.
Троянският кон, и рууткита, съществуват не като самостоятелни процеси, а като DLL тредове, под юриздикцията на services.exe което позволява, на троянският кон да следи клавиатурата, и на рууткита да го прикрива успeшно.
За да се свърже с неговата ботмрежа, троянският кон, стартира множество UDP връзки от локален порт 54946 на зарdзеният компютър, до отдалечен порт 16470 на произволно генерирани имена, физически пръснати по целия свят, откъдето вземат командите си от command & control или предава вече събраната информация от клавиатурата.
